5. Royal Exile has the benefit of racing experience, and he did beat older horses in good fashion at Taree just before Christmas. If there’s a concern it is that he was quite green, baulking on the post, but he showed a nice turn of foot to pick them up from midfield. If he’s learnt from that, and can be handy to the pace, he could get away with it. Wary of the Waterhouse-Bott colt 4. Proton, which has trialled twice over the 850m or thereabouts and there was significant improvement into the second. Imagine he leads from the inside gate and the 1200m will suit. There was nothing wrong with the latest trial by 3. Gold Globe over 1030m. He looked to lengthen quite well late there. It might be a bit too soon for 2. Audit, looking at his latest trial, but it is a small field and he could run well.How to play it: Royal Exile to win.

Bjorn Baker believes Amor Victorious is “very close” to his best in his comeback from injury, while Robusto can never be written off as the Warwick Farm trainer chases the $500,000 The Lakes Mile at Wyong on Saturday.
The Darby Racing pair were on the second line of betting at $6 (TAB) on Friday for the feature, which was down to just 10 runners after multiple scratchings. Favourite Know Thyself was into $2.90.
